远程重启服务器命令Linux,Linux远程重启服务器命令详解及实际应用案例
- 综合资讯
- 2025-04-01 12:21:20
- 3

Linux远程重启服务器命令详解,涵盖SSH连接、执行重启命令及脚本自动化等实际应用案例,助您高效管理远程服务器。...
Linux远程重启服务器命令详解,涵盖SSH连接、执行重启命令及脚本自动化等实际应用案例,助您高效管理远程服务器。
在Linux系统中,远程重启服务器是日常运维工作中常见的需求,通过远程重启服务器,可以解决服务器出现故障或需要升级等情况,本文将详细介绍Linux远程重启服务器的命令,并提供实际应用案例。
远程重启服务器的命令
图片来源于网络,如有侵权联系删除
SSH远程登录
在Linux系统中,远程重启服务器首先需要通过SSH协议登录到目标服务器,以下是一个SSH远程登录的示例:
ssh username@server_ip
username
为登录目标服务器的用户名,server_ip
为目标服务器的IP地址。
重启服务器命令
在SSH登录成功后,可以使用以下命令重启服务器:
(1)重启整个系统
sudo shutdown -r now
这条命令会立即重启整个系统。
(2)重启单个服务
对于某些服务,如Apache、Nginx等,可以使用以下命令重启:
sudo systemctl restart service_name
service_name
为需要重启的服务名称。
(3)重启网络服务
对于网络服务,如SSH、HTTP等,可以使用以下命令重启:
sudo systemctl restart network.service
重启网络接口
在某些情况下,可能需要重启网络接口,以下命令可以用于重启网络接口:
sudo ifconfig eth0 down sudo ifconfig eth0 up
eth0
为网络接口名称。
图片来源于网络,如有侵权联系删除
实际应用案例
远程重启Web服务器
假设Web服务器运行在IP地址为192.168.1.100的Linux服务器上,用户名为webuser
,以下为重启Web服务器的步骤:
(1)SSH远程登录到Web服务器:
ssh webuser@192.168.1.100
(2)重启Apache服务:
sudo systemctl restart apache2
远程重启数据库服务器
假设数据库服务器运行在IP地址为192.168.1.101的Linux服务器上,用户名为dbuser
,以下为重启数据库服务器的步骤:
(1)SSH远程登录到数据库服务器:
ssh dbuser@192.168.1.101
(2)重启MySQL服务:
sudo systemctl restart mysqld
远程重启文件服务器
假设文件服务器运行在IP地址为192.168.1.102的Linux服务器上,用户名为fileuser
,以下为重启文件服务器的步骤:
(1)SSH远程登录到文件服务器:
ssh fileuser@192.168.1.102
(2)重启NFS服务:
sudo systemctl restart nfs-server
本文详细介绍了Linux远程重启服务器的命令及其应用案例,通过掌握这些命令,可以方便地在Linux系统中进行远程重启操作,提高运维效率,在实际应用中,可以根据具体需求选择合适的命令进行操作。
本文链接:https://www.zhitaoyun.cn/1968157.html
发表评论